Full Screen Mario is a 2013 browser game created by American programmer Josh Goldberg. It is an unofficial remake of the 1985 game Super Mario Bros. and was built using HTML5. As a remake of Super Mario Bros. (1985), Full Screen Mario's gameplay is similar: it is a side-scrolling platform game in which the player controls Mario through levels.
